Garlic (Allium Sativum)

A.K.A.: Clove garlic, Poor-man's-treacle
Part Used: Bulb

Garlic is nature's antibiotic. It is effective against bacteria that may be resistant to other antibiotics, and it stimulates the lymphatic system to throw off waste material. Unlike other antibiotics, garlic does not destroy the body's natural flora. Instead, it has the ability to stimulate cell growth and activity, thus rejuvenating all bodily functions.

Research has discovered many benefits of garlic. Louis Pasteur found that garlic contains antibiotic properties. Albert Schweitzer used garlic, when in Africa, for treating amebic dysentery and as an antiseptic in preventing infections.

Garlic is known to be effective in inhibiting bacterial growth and many different strains of Mycobacterium, viruses, worms and fungi.

Garlic is linked to lower incidence of cardiovascular disease. It has been found to reduce cholesterol and triglyceride levels in the blood, lower blood pressure, increase immunity and reduce blood's clotting ability. Garlic was able to benefit individuals suffering from peripheral arterial occlusive disease, blood clots in the legs.

Antitumor properties are found in garlic and studies have shown it has the ability to inhibit the growth of cancer causing nitrosamine.
